RE: The tariff classification of a woman’s jacket from Taiwan.

Dear Ms. Berlant:

In your letter dated February 10, 2000, on behalf of Fred Meyer Inc., you requested a tariff classification ruling.

The submitted sample, Style #4536 is a woman’s jacket composed of knit 100% polyester tricot fabric coated with PVC that completely obscures the underlying fabric. The lining is 75% polyester and 25% rayon fabric. The garment has an attached drawstring hood, two vertical yokes on the front and back of the body, two horizontal zippered pockets below the waist and a full front zippered closure.

The applicable subheading for the women’s jacket, Style #4536 will be 6113.00.1010,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TS), which provides for “Garments, made up of knitted or crocheted fabrics of heading 5903, 3906, 5907: Having an outer surface impregnated, coated, covered, or laminated with rubber or plastics material which completely obscures the underlying fabric, Coats an jackets: Women’s or girls’.” The rate of duty will be 5.3%.

This ruling is being issued under the provisions of Part 177 of the Customs Regulations (19 C.F.R. 177).
